What Is a Digital Marketing Agency?

A digital marketing agencies is a company that plans, executes, and manages online marketing campaigns on behalf of a client. Instead of building an in-house team from scratch, businesses hire agencies to handle everything from search engine optimization and paid advertising to social media management, content creation, and web design.

Most agencies fall into one of a few categories:

  • Full-service digital marketing agencies that manage every channel under one roof
  • Specialist agencies that focus deeply on one discipline, such as SEO or performance marketing
  • Boutique or creative agencies that lean heavily on branding and content storytelling
  • Network agencies that operate as part of larger global holding companies (Dentsu, Publicis, WPP, IPG)

The line between these categories has blurred in recent years. Many specialist agencies now offer bundled services, and full-service shops often have dedicated pods for SEO, paid media, and content, run almost like internal specialist teams.

Why Businesses Hire Digital Marketing Agencies?

Most companies don’t hire an agency because they don’t understand marketing — they hire one because building and retaining an in-house team with expertise across ten different disciplines is expensive, slow, and hard to scale.

Here’s what typically pushes a business toward hiring an agency instead of going it alone:

  • Speed to execution. Agencies already have processes, tools, and talent in place. There’s no three-month hiring runway before campaigns go live.
  • Access to specialized skill sets. SEO, paid media, marketing automation, and content strategy each require distinct expertise. Few in-house teams can cover all of them well.
  • Objectivity. An external partner isn’t tied to internal politics or legacy assumptions about “what’s worked before.” That often leads to sharper strategy.
  • Tool and platform costs. Enterprise SEO, analytics, and automation platforms are expensive. Agencies spread that cost across multiple clients.
  • Scalability. Agencies can flex resources up or down as campaigns and budgets change, which is harder to do with a fixed internal headcount.

Services Offered by Digital Marketing Agencies in India

Most of the best digital marketing agencies in India offer a broad menu of services, though the depth of expertise in each varies. Here’s what each core service actually covers.

SEO (Search Engine Optimization)

The practice of improving a website’s visibility in organic search results through content, technical fixes, and authority-building (backlinks, digital PR).

Local SEO

Optimization focused on local search visibility — Google Business Profile management, local citations, and location-specific landing pages. Critical for businesses with physical locations or service areas.

Technical SEO

Behind-the-scenes optimization covering site speed, crawlability, indexing, structured data (schema markup), and mobile usability. Often the difference between content that ranks and content that doesn’t.

PPC (Pay-Per-Click Advertising)

Paid campaigns where you pay per click or impression, typically run through Google Ads, Bing Ads, or social platforms. Delivers faster results than SEO but requires ongoing budget.

Google Ads

Search, display, shopping, and YouTube advertising through Google’s ad network — one of the most common performance marketing channels for Indian businesses.

Meta Ads

Paid advertising across Facebook and Instagram, ranging from awareness campaigns to conversion-focused retargeting.

Social Media Marketing

Organic content strategy, community management, and paid social campaigns across platforms like Instagram, LinkedIn, and X.

Content Marketing

Blog posts, guides, videos, and other content designed to attract, educate, and convert audiences — often the backbone of a long-term SEO strategy.

Email Marketing

Automated and campaign-based email communication for nurturing leads, retaining customers, and driving repeat sales.

Influencer Marketing

Partnering with creators to promote products or services to their audience — increasingly important for D2C and consumer brands in India.

Web Design

Designing and building websites optimized for both user experience and conversion, often integrated with SEO best practices from the start.

Branding

Developing brand identity, positioning, messaging, and visual language — usually handled by agencies with strong creative teams.

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O)

Testing and refining website elements (landing pages, forms, checkout flows) to increase the percentage of visitors who convert into leads or customers.

Marketing Automation

Using tools like HubSpot, Zoho, or Mailchimp to automate lead nurturing, email sequences, and customer journeys at scale.

Analytics & Reporting

Tracking campaign performance through tools like Google Analytics 4, Search Console, and custom dashboards — the foundation of any transparent agency relationship.

How to Choose the Right Digital Marketing Agencies in India

With hundreds of options claiming to be a “full-service digital marketing agencies,” the decision often comes down to a handful of practical factors.

1. Experience

Look beyond years in business. Ask how long the agency has worked in your specific industry and what results they’ve delivered for similar-sized companies.

2. Portfolio

A strong portfolio should show variety and depth — not just logos, but specific outcomes (traffic growth, lead volume) tied to real campaigns.

3. Industry Expertise

An agency that understands your sector’s buying cycle, compliance requirements, and audience behavior will get to results faster than a generalist.

4. Pricing

Understand whether pricing is retainer-based, project-based, or performance-based, and make sure it aligns with your budget and expected timeline for results.

5. Transparency

Ask directly: Will you have access to ad accounts and analytics dashboards? Will you know exactly where your budget is going each month?

6. Reviews

Check third-party platforms like Clutch, Google Reviews, and G2 rather than relying solely on testimonials on the agency’s own website.

7. Communication

A good digital marketing agencies should offer regular check-ins, a dedicated point of contact, and clear escalation paths when something isn’t working.

8. Reporting

Ask for a sample report before signing. It should be easy to understand, tied to business outcomes, and delivered on a predictable schedule.

9. Certifications

Look for certifications like Google Partner, Meta Business Partner, or HubSpot Solutions Partner — these indicate a baseline level of platform expertise and access to better support channels.

Common Pricing Models Followed by Indian Agencies

Digital marketing agencies pricing in India varies widely, but most agencies structure their fees using one of the following models:

  • Monthly Retainer: A fixed monthly fee covering an agreed scope of services — the most common model for SEO, social media, and ongoing content work. Typically ranges from ₹20,000 to ₹5,00,000+ per month depending on scope and company size.
  • Project-Based Pricing: A one-time fee for a defined deliverable, such as a website redesign, a brand identity project, or a single campaign.
  • Percentage of Ad Spend: Common for PPC and performance marketing, where the agency charges a percentage (often 10–20%) of the total ad budget managed.
  • Performance-Based Pricing: Fees tied to specific outcomes, such as cost-per-lead or cost-per-acquisition targets — less common but growing among performance-focused agencies.
  • Hourly Consulting: Typically used for strategy consulting, audits, or short-term specialist engagements rather than full campaign management.

Digital Marketing Trends in India for 2026

The digital marketing agencies landscape keeps shifting, and the agencies that stay ahead of these trends tend to deliver better long-term results for clients:

  1. Generative Engine Optimization (GEO): As AI-powered search tools and chat-based assistants become common discovery channels, agencies are optimizing content to appear in AI-generated answers, not just traditional search rankings.
  2. AI-assisted content and campaign management: Agencies increasingly use AI for content ideation, ad copy variations, and campaign optimization, while still relying on human strategists for judgment calls.
  3. First-party data strategies: With growing privacy regulation and the decline of third-party cookies, agencies are helping brands build owned data assets through email, CRM, and loyalty programs.
  4. Regional-language content: Brands are investing more in Hindi and regional-language content and ads to reach India’s fast-growing non-metro internet user base.
  5. Short-form video dominance: Instagram Reels and YouTube Shorts continue to drive engagement, pushing agencies to build video-first content pipelines.
  6. Performance creative: The line between “creative” and “performance” teams is blurring, with agencies building creative specifically designed for measurable conversion outcomes.
  7. Voice and conversational search: Optimization for voice assistants and conversational queries is becoming a standard part of SEO strategy.
  8. Marketing automation and CRM integration: More Indian SMEs are adopting automation tools, pushing agencies to build integrated, cross-channel customer journeys rather than isolated campaigns.
